What is the relationship between gas and smart contracts in blockchain?
lolo rasheedMar 04, 2022 · 4 years ago3 answers
Can you explain the relationship between gas and smart contracts in the blockchain? How does gas affect the execution of smart contracts?
3 answers
- Minh DoMay 09, 2022 · 4 years agoGas is a measure of computational effort required to execute operations on the Ethereum blockchain. Smart contracts on the blockchain require gas to perform any action. Gas is used to pay for the computational resources required to execute the code of the smart contract. The more complex the smart contract, the more gas it will require. Gas fees are paid in Ether, the native cryptocurrency of the Ethereum blockchain. So, in short, gas is the fuel that powers the execution of smart contracts on the blockchain.
